    I have a similar quilt. I had a bunch of black and white strip blocks that were different sizes, different cuts, some mostly black, some mostly white. They hung around for years because I didn't know what to do with them. About a year and a half ago, I experimented, adding fabric as necessary, and cutting and sewing the pieces and blocks together in various ways, until I could square them all up to 12 1/2". I added some squares of a black/white/red print. Since I do quilt-as-you-go, I backed the print "sandwiches" with one colorway of a fabric I liked, the white strip blocks with another colorway of the same print, and the black ones with a third colorway. After quilting each one, I put them together with white sashing. It's now my favorite quilt --- reversible --- from scraps and orphan blocks I nearly threw away as unusable.
